The Matrix shoots itself in the foot

Some of you MMO vets may find this interesting, I've been following it for a while with utter fascination.

As some of you know MxO has a very small community, it's based around fans of the Matrix series and Sci-Fi, not hard-core MMO gaming. It just can't compete with the big boys like Blizzard and SOE in terms of gameplay and content and the players were fine with that. They released a live event schedule through the summer as well as new content. Fans were thrilled. They also did an excellent job in proving itself a worthy alternative to Anarchy Online. Like AO, there are 2 ways to get XP. Kill random Mobs/gangs, or do Missions. Like AO at release, Missions are the easiest method. You use your cellphone to call your contact and then run the mission. 5-20 minutes later, you'll gain 5% to 10% (lvl1-20) or 1% to 5% xp (from 20-50) of your lvl xp depending on it. The timesink is running to the buildings, nothing else. But this timesink adds up to far more time than the actual fighting inside the mission.

Like all MMORPGs, MxO released early.

Week 1

However on release there was a building that allowed players to do their missions in a single building, never having to run. This allowed quite a few people to level up to 50 in under a week by playing 20 hours a day.


MxO response?


Nerf the building, leave the 50s alone.


However anyone caught using it after the first week was banned/suspended without hesitation rather than remove the missions from that building. And it is VERY possible to pull missions in that building and have no idea it's exploiting.


Week 2

Spies realize they can use Invisibility to simply run through a mission to grab objectives and gain 5 levels a day. For some reason sneak actually means sneak!


MxO nerfs Spies so their only contribution is picking locks.

Meanwhile the playerbase is jumping up and down mad over a few dozen level 50s that cheated their way there and are reaping the rewards while unfortunately the rest of the playerbase are starting to chant the Mantra: "Exploit Now, Exploit Often, because they will nerf it".

Now here's the question kiddies: If you're Warner Bros. Do you go ahead and ban those level 50s? Do you hurry up and fix the Spy Branch? Do you add more rewards and skills from level 30-49 thus penalizing those cheaters? Nah...



Week 2.5

MxO cuts all XP and rewards for missions in half. At the high-end as much as 60-75% meaning xp is slightly slower than EQ was at release. MxO is now a ghost-town.
